Legacy Rise Sports Boxer represents Ghana at a UK International Boxing Tournament

In alignment with its mission to provide global exposure and opportunities for young athletes, Legacy Rise Sports proudly sponsored of its amateur boxers, Abraham Mensah, to represent Ghana at the prestigious ‘Luton Sports Carnival’ in the United Kingdom which took place on September 21, 2024.
The tournament, which featured top talents from around the world, offered a platform for Abraham to showcase his skills on an international stage.

The event reflects Legacy Rise Sports’ commitment to empowering athletes by creating pathways to compete at the highest levels. Speaking on the experience, Mr. Mensah expressed immense gratitude “This is a dream come true. Competing internationally is an incredible opportunity, and I’m grateful to Legacy Rise Sports for believing in me and supporting my journey. I’ll continue to give my best and make my country proud.”
CEO of Legacy Rise Sports, Sharaf Mahama, also shared his excitement about the tournament: “Our mission has always been to create opportunities for athletes to shine on a global scale. This tournament is just the beginning of many more international ventures for our athletes. We are proud of Abraham and look forward to his continued success.”
With this successful trip, Legacy Rise Sports reaffirms its dedication to developing world-class athletes and expanding their horizons through international exposure.
